How much do python data anal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for python data analyst in Raleigh, NC is $80,333.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$60,800.00 and $94,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Python data analyst do?

A Python Data Analyst leverages the Python programming language to collect, process, and analyze large sets of data. They use tools and libraries like Pandas, NumPy, and Matplotlib to clean data, perform statistical analysis, and create visualizations that help organizations make data-driven decisions. Their role often involves extracting insights from complex datasets, automating data workflows, and communicating findings to stakeholders through reports or dashboards. Python Data Analysts play a crucial part in turning raw data into actionable business intelligence.

What does a Python data analyst do?

As a Python data analyst, you use the Python programming language to develop tools for data mining, analysis, and data visualization. You typically develop a script to meet the specific data needs of your client or employer. Then, you test your code and perform debugging duties before deploying it in a live environment. Some data analysts also have algorithm creation responsibilities. In this case, after creating and testing an algorithm, you use Python with your algorithm to interpret data. You also develop reports to show to your clients or employers, and you may code a web app or interface that clients can use to visualize data sets.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Python data anal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Python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, a solid grasp of statistics, and proficiency in Python programming, often supported by a degree in data science, mathematics, or a related field. Familiarity with data analysis libraries like pandas and NumPy, visualization tools such as Matplotlib or Seaborn, and experience with data querying languages like SQL are typically required. Attention to detail, critical thinking, and effective communication help you derive insights and present findings clearly to stakeholders. These skills and qualities are vital for transforming raw data into actionable business intelligence and supporting data-driven decision-making.

How do Python data analysts typ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

Python Data Analysts often work closely with teams such as marketing, finance, and product development to provide data-driven insights that inform business decisions. They regularly participate in cross-functional meetings to understand departmental objectives, gather requirements for data analysis, and present their findings in an accessible manner. Effective communication and the ability to translate technical results into actionable recommendations are essential, as analysts often act as a bridge between technical data and non-technical stakeholders.

What is the difference between Python Data Analyst vs Data Scientist?

AspectPython Data AnalystData Scientist
Required SkillsPython, SQL, data visualization, statistical analysisPython, R, machine learning, statistical modeling
Work EnvironmentBusiness analytics, reporting, data cleaningAdvanced modeling, predictive analytics, research
Industry UsageFinance, marketing, healthcare, retailTech, finance, research, AI development

While both roles require Python and data analysis skills, Data Scientists typically engage in more complex modeling and machine learning, whereas Python Data Analysts focus on data cleaning, visualization, and reporting to support business decisions.

Is Python good for data analysts?

Python is widely used by data analysts due to its simplicity, extensive libraries like pandas and NumPy, and strong community support. It enables efficient data manipulation, analysis, and visualization, making it a valuable skill for the role.
